Following the success of the service in Oxford, Community Internet plc has today launched its WiMAX-ready service, RedKite, in central London. The extension of the service to London comes on the back of a successful commercial pilot, which has been operating in Oxford since January.

Community Internet have launched a revolutionary new wireless broadband service known as RedKite. A high-speed, always on Internet connection, RedKite combines the bandwidth and reliability available with fibre-based solutions but at a price aligned with business DSL services. The result is an extremely competitively priced high bandwidth broadband service.
